Been a subscribed for both my kids for almost a year now. Great customer service when reaching out. Firstly the magazines were being delivered in the rain and hence sometimes they came completely soaked. After contacting them they sent me out new copies and also took on board the feedback (I assume from many people) and now deliver in a biodegradeable water proof bag.
I had also some administrative issues with the account and the delivery name and got immediate replies and help to resolve my issue.
Very pleasant interactions as well as quick responses (very surprised!)
